California Penal Code Section 637.1

Every person not connected with any telegraph or telephone
office who, without the authority or consent of the person to whom
the same may be directed, willfully opens any sealed envelope
enclosing a telegraphic or telephonic message, addressed to another
person, with the purpose of learning the contents of such message, or
who fraudulently represents another person and thereby procures to
be delivered to himself any telegraphic or telephonic message
addressed to such other person, with the intent to use, destroy, or
detain the same from the person entitled to receive such message, is
punishable as provided in Section 637.
